如何通过命令行关闭 MySQL
作为一个刚入行的小白,你可能会对如何使用命令行管理 MySQL 数据库感到有些困惑。在本文中,我们将详细讲解如何通过命令行关闭 MySQL。
整体流程
关闭 MySQL 服务的过程可以分为以下几个步骤。下表简要说明了每一步需要做的内容:
步骤编号 | 步骤内容 | 命令 |
---|---|---|
1 | 打开命令行工具 | Windows: cmd / macOS: Terminal |
2 | 登录 MySQL 服务 | mysql -u root -p |
3 | 关闭 MySQL | mysqladmin -u root -p shutdown |
4 | 确认 MySQL 是否已关闭 | 通过检查 MySQL 状态 |
详细步骤解析
在深入每一步之前,确保你的 MySQL 服务已经在运行。接下来,我们将逐步介绍如何操作。
第一步:打开命令行工具
- Windows: 按下
Windows + R
,输入cmd
,然后按Enter
。 - macOS: 打开
Spotlight
,搜索Terminal
,并打开它。
第二步:登录 MySQL 服务
要与 MySQL 服务器进行交互,你需要登录到 MySQL。
mysql -u root -p
mysql
: 调用 MySQL 客户端程序。-u root
: 指定用户名为root
,这是默认的管理员用户名。-p
: 提示你输入密码。
输入上述命令后,你会看到一个提示,要求你输入密码。这是 MySQL root
用户的密码,输入后按下 Enter
继续。
第三步:关闭 MySQL
登录成功后,输入以下命令来关闭 MySQL 服务:
mysqladmin -u root -p shutdown
mysqladmin
: MySQL 的管理工具,允许你执行管理操作。-u root
: 指明使用root
用户。-p
: 再次要求您输入密码。shutdown
: 关闭 MySQL 服务的命令。
输入命令并按下 Enter
键后,MySQL 服务就会开始关闭。
第四步:确认 MySQL 是否已关闭
可以通过以下命令检查 MySQL 服务的状态:
systemctl status mysql
如果 MySQL 已成功关闭,你会看到类似以下的输出:
● mysql.service
Loaded: loaded (/lib/systemd/system/mysql.service; enabled; vendor preset: enabled)
Active: inactive (dead)
在这个状态信息中,Active: inactive (dead)
表明 MySQL 服务已经关闭。
流程图
下面是关闭 MySQL 服务的流程图,方便你更好地理解整个过程。
flowchart TD
A[打开命令行工具] --> B[登录 MySQL 服务]
B --> C[关闭 MySQL]
C --> D[确认 MySQL 是否已关闭]
饼状图
为了更直观地展示整个过程的各个步骤所占的比例,我们将使用饼状图来表示这些步骤。
pie
title 关闭 MySQL 的步骤占比
"打开命令行工具": 25
"登录 MySQL 服务": 25
"关闭 MySQL": 30
"确认 MySQL 是否已关闭": 20
结尾
通过本文的详细介绍,相信你已经掌握了如何通过命令行关闭 MySQL 服务的步骤。无论是在个人项目还是在企业应用中,了解如何管理数据库是非常重要的基本技能。希望这篇文章能够帮助你在以后的开发工作中更加得心应手。如果你还有其他问题或需要进一步的帮助,欢迎随时询问。祝你在数据库管理的道路上越走越远!